sing, maiden sing!
mouths were made for singing;
listen, ** songs thou’lt hear
through the wide world ringing;
songs from all the birds
songs from winds and showers
songs from seas and streams
even from sweet flowers
hear’st thou the rain
how it gently falleth?
hearest thou the bird
who from forest calleth?
hearest thou the bee
o’er the sunflower ringing?
tell us, maiden, now **
should’st thou not be singing?
hear’st thou the breeze
round the rose*bud sighing?
and the sweet small rose
love to love replying?
so should’st thou rеply
to the pray’r we’re bringing:
so that bud, thy mouth
should brеak forth in singing!
